How DeFi Integration Should Work on Your Phone

Whoa!

First: tight dApp browser integration, but sandboxed. Second: transaction previews that are human readable. Third: clear toggles for advanced settings. The longer thought here is that wallets must translate on-chain jargon into plain language without hiding risk—so users can see what a contract call actually does (transfer tokens, grant allowance, stake), and then decide, because where people really slip up is misinterpreting approvals and repeated allowances that let a contract drain funds later.

Seriously?

Yeah. I learned that the hard way once when a careless approval let a buggy contract move tokens it shouldn’t have. Not fun. So an ideal app warns about unlimited allowances and suggests safer patterns, offers one-tap revocation links, and surfaces gas-estimates in native dollars with context. Also smart routing for swaps—cheap routes, but optional splitting across liquidity sources for slippage-sensitive trades—because price matters and users hate losing value to bad routing.

Okay, so check this out—

One practical approach is an integrated aggregator that explains routes. Short version: show best price, worst-case slippage, and the sources of liquidity. Longer thought: combining that with hardware confirmation means a user can initiate a complex multi-hop swap on their phone and then sign the final raw transaction on their hardware device, which drastically reduces the attack surface because the private key never touched the online device that built the transaction.

Hardware Support: Why It Changes the Risk Equation

Whoa!

Hardware wallets make a big difference. Period. They remove the single point of failure for private keys. But integration isn’t trivial. The wallet must talk to the device over USB, Bluetooth, or WebAuthn proxies and still keep flows sane. And there’s a subtle UX thing: people want assurance that the address displayed on their hardware matches the address shown in the mobile app—confirmations should line up perfectly, otherwise trust frays.

Hmm…

On one hand, hardware adds friction—carry another device, pair it, update firmware—on the other hand, for many users that friction is worth it because they sleep better. Initially I thought only whales would care. Actually, wait—retail users care too when they realize a single phishing email could cost them retirement funds. So the solution is optional friction: make hardware support easy to enable and painless for daily use, while still being rock-solid during key operations like token approvals or large transfers.

I’m biased here because I prefer cold storage, but I live in the real world where I want to check my portfolio over coffee without taking my Ledger out every time. So the wallet needs a trusted pairing system and selective signing—daily small approvals on the mobile key, large approvals require the hardware. That gradation protects users without making crypto feel like a bank vault overkill for minor things.

Really?

Yes. And adding account management—labeling, whitelisting DApps, and transaction histories—makes hardware usability much better because you can audit behavior. Also a cross-device sync that doesn’t expose keys but syncs metadata and preferences is clutch for real users who jump between devices and expect continuity.

FAQ

Do I need a hardware wallet if I use a mobile DeFi wallet?

Short answer: not always, but it’s highly recommended for large balances. Small daily amounts can live on mobile keys for convenience, though anything sizable should be moved to cold storage. Longer thought: treating your funds as tiers—spendable balance vs long-term hold—lets you enjoy DeFi while still protecting the core of your wealth, and the best wallets let you manage both without ceremony.

Will hardware pairing break DeFi dApp flows?

Mostly no, if the wallet supports native signing and transaction handoff properly. Real world friction exists, but good implementations allow the dApp flow to be built on the phone and finalized on the hardware device, which keeps UX smooth. I’m not 100% sure every dApp will behave perfectly, but the ecosystem is moving toward standardization and better UX patterns.
